70-290 : Managing and Maintaining a Windows 2003 Environment
with Rafiq Wayani



View Course Outline

Managing and Maintaining a Microsoft Windows Server 2003 Environment course will give you the knowledge and skills necessary to prepare to pass Microsoft exam 70-290. This course is intended for individuals pursuing the MCSA or MCSE on Windows Server 2003 certification.

Course includes 27+ hours of total training time...

  • 6 modules of training
  • Over 9 hours of media run time

Course Outline (Outlines are subject to change.)

Managing and Maintaining a Windows
Server 2003 Environment

Sessions Run Time
6 9 hours

This is the first course in the MCSA and MCSE on Windows Server 2003 tracks and serves as an entry point for all other courses in the Windows Server 2003 curriculum. It is intended for those individuals who are, or are aspiring to be, systems administrators or systems engineers.

In this course you will learn how to:

  • Manage users, computers, and groups
  • Manage network resources
  • Manage organizational units based on Active Directory
  • Implement group policy
  • Manage data storage

Introduction

  • Windows environment
  • Administration tools
  • Using the Run As feature
  • Create an organizational unit
  • Connecting to the server

Managing System Resources

  • Using the Active Directory Users and Computers tool
  • Resource access
  • Creating shared folders
  • Establishing resource rights and privileges
  • Creating printers
  • Managing printers
  • Searching and assigning permissions for printers
  • Assigning permissions to manage organizational units
  • Changing permission of resources within Active Directory

Group Policy

  • Creating and applying Group Policy objects
  • Testing and changing Group Policy object
  • Creating scripts using Group Policy
  • Establishing methods of redirecting folders
  • Assessing if a Group Policy has been applied

Security

  • Implementing security in Windows Server 2003
  • Creating and using security templates
  • Testing security policies
  • Creating and managing security logs

Server Administration

  • Remote Desktop
  • Remote Console
  • Managing Remote Connections
  • Monitor performance
  • Viewing and setting alerts
  • Viewing and setting counters
  • Monitor disks
  • Monitor CPU
  • Monitor network usage
  • Managing device drivers
  • Correcting device driver installation

Managing Disks and Storage

  • Install and configure disks
  • Converting disks between different file systems (NTFS, FAT, FAT32)
  • File compression
  • File encryption
  • Disk quotas
  • Backup and restore data
  • Backup and restore System State
